Russian GP: Raikkonen not happy with handling

Russian GP: Raikkonen not happy with handling In the morning session Ferrari was spent focusing on an evaluation of new aero parts and in the afternoon in Sochi the team also looked at race pace. Kimi Raikkonen completed 35 laps on his way to fourth fastest in 1.38.793. Topping the time sheet was Lewis Hamilton (1.37.583) in the Mercedes. Splitting Vettel and Raikkonen was Nico Rosberg who produced a 1.38.450, running Soft tyres on the other Mercedes. Kimi not entirely happy with handling yet “It was not an ideal day, one of those days you struggle to make the tires work and get the car where you want.
